I have followed the video for merging columns across classes successfully and I am now pulling data from three classes into a master class to track percentages in tests.

However, I cannot get it to collate the grades (A* - U), does this column merging not work with strings of data?

It works with Text based grades but formulas take its value as a percentage.
A* is a 1.00 (or what you've configured) B is 0.7 and so on..

On the Formula's header (double tap header) > Grade type > Select your grade type (A* - U)

Now add the function COLUMNRESULT (it is in the 'Legacy functions' list) wrapped around what you've typed now


COLUMNRESULT (COLUMN1)

or

COLUMNRESULT ( COLUMN1 + COLUMN2 + COLUMN 3)
